Founded in 1965, Herc Rentals is one of the leading equipment rental suppliers in North America with trailing twelve month total revenues of nearly $2.53 billion as of September 30, 2022. Herc Rentals’ parent company, known as Herc Holdings Inc., listed on the New York Stock Exchange on July 1, 2016, under the symbol “HRI.” Herc Rentals serves customers through approximately 350 locations and has approximately 6,500 employees in North America.

 

We serve a diverse group of customers in a wide array of industries. We support professional con-tractors in construction and remediation. Our industrial customers include large industrial plants, refineries and petrochemical operations, automotive and aerospace manufacturers. We support government and infrastructure projects at the municipal, state and federal level. And, we continue to expand our services for customers in commercial and retail, healthcare, hospitality, recreation, and entertainment and special events.

Short Description

Under the primary direction of the Regional Director of Safety with a dotted line to the Sr. DOT Manager

Regional DOT Manager performs activities primarily related to DOT compliance and driver safety training.

Responsibilities

The key responsibilities and accountabilities for the incumbent are to:

  • Oversee all aspects of Regional DOT Compliance to prevent DOT violations and lower DOT Safer Score.
  • Monitor and perform driver coaching sessions for flagged incidents in the Electronic Monitoring Program
  • Monitor region drivers using current ELD system computer platform ensuring all drivers RODS/ELD are compliant with DOT guidelines.
  • Attend regular weekly driver safety meetings for each region/district.
  • Troubleshoot and provide guidance to region drivers on ELD device issues.  Ensure all driver devices are functioning properly.  
  • Conduct Driver Safety Training for all regional employees. Ensure all employees have driver training.
  • Monitor new hires to ensure Driver Safety training attendance within 45 days of hire. 
  • Train new CMV Drivers using the Driver Equipment Qualification Standard (DEQS), To ensure newly hired drivers understand proper tiedown procedures and policies surrounding pickup/delivery and customer satisfaction.
  • Ride with drivers and provide coaching as necessary on the job performance, i.e. Load Securement, driving habits.
  • Visit each branch and conduct DOT Annual Audit. Ensuring branches comply with DOT regulations.  
  • Conduct Truck Inspections using Herc DOT Truck Inspection platform to ensure trucks meet DOT and Herc safety requirements.
